§ 506 Vessel Lien Sale Requirements

This law says that before a boat can be sold to pay off a debt, the boat must be shown to the public for at least one hour, must be at the sale spot when the sale happens, no secret bids are allowed, and the sale must be run fairly.

Key Takeaways

  • •The boat must be available for public inspection for at least one hour before the sale.
  • •The boat has to be at the sale location at the time and date listed in the notice.
  • •Sealed (secret) bids cannot be used.
  • •The lienholder must run the sale in a commercially reasonable (fair) manner.

Example

A bank wants to auction a fishing boat because the owner stopped paying the loan.

The bank has to park the boat where anyone can look at it for at least an hour before the auction, make sure the boat is actually there on the day of the auction, cannot accept hidden sealed bids, and must run the auction in a normal, fair way.

§ 506 Vessel Lien Sale Requirements

No lien sale shall be undertaken pursuant to Section 503 or 504 unless the vessel has been available for inspection at a location easily accessible to the public for at least one hour before the sale and is at the place of sale at the time and date specified on the notice of sale. Sealed bids shall not be accepted. The lienholder shall conduct the sale in a commercially reasonable manner. (Added by Stats. 1982, Ch. 941, Sec. 2.)
